Title: A People in Distress : Being a Connected Account of the Namas from 1812 A.D. Down to the Present Day ..,.Vol. II.
Description: Calcutta, Mrs. Kadambini Roy, (March 1992). orig.wrappers. 21x13cm, (166) pp. Pagination runs vii, 113-260, xii pp.. Rubbed. Good. ¶ Volume 2 only. A history of the Namassej (Namasudra) scheduled caste of Bengal. Concerns 1919-1947. Contents: Namasudras on the March; A Controversial Leader; Namasudra Society on the Eve of Independence. Full title reads: "A People in Distress Being a Connected Account of the Namas from 1812 A.D. Down to the Present Day Together with a Study of their Antiquity : Vol. II
